Potsdam vs Winfield Lock & Dam, Wv Climate & Distance Between

Usa flag
  • The distance between Potsdam, Germany and Winfield Lock & Dam, Wv, Usa is approximately 7,018 km or 4,361 mi.
  • To reach Potsdam in this distance one would set out from Winfield Lock & Dam, Wv bearing 43°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Potsdam bearing 119.1° or ESE .
  • Potsdam has a marine west coast climate (Cfb) whereas Winfield Lock & Dam, Wv has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
  • Potsdam is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Winfield Lock & Dam, Wv is in or near the warm temperate moist forest biome.
  • The mean annual temperature is 3.6 °C (6.5°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 5.4 °C (9.7°F) less in Potsdam. The continentality subtype is semicontinental as opposed to subcontinental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 462.6 mm (18.2 in) less which is equivalent to 462.6 l/m² (11.35 US gal/ft²) or 4,626,000 l/ha (494,550 US gal/ac) less. About 5/9 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 13.9° lower in Potsdam than in Winfield Lock & Dam, Wv.
